Field of the Invention The present invention is used at the time of installing an elevator for performing work in a hoistway using a car in a temporary state as a working scaffold, and the car is raised and lowered by driving a self-propelled hoist. The present invention relates to a lift device for elevator installation and a method of assembling the same.

で昇降させるものが提案されている。2. Description of the Related Art Heretofore, as an elevator device of this type for elevator installation, for example,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open Nos. 58-47883, 61-45876 and 61-200 have been disclosed.
As disclosed in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No. 877, a winch for winding a wire rope is installed at a lower part of a hoistway, and the wire rope is wound around a pulley installed at an upper part of the hoistway, and one end of the winch is placed on an upper part of a car. And a car is lifted in a hoistway by winding a wire rope with the winch.

用できないという問題がある。[0003] However, in the elevator installation elevator, it is necessary to wind the wire rope with a winch installed at the lower part of the hoistway, and to wind the wire rope around a pulley installed at the upper part of the hoistway. When installing an elevator for a skyscraper that goes up and down to above, the wire rope cannot be wound up because the wire rope becomes so long that it exceeds the limit of the winch winding ability. There is a problem that it cannot be applied to an elevator for a high-rise building.
